Step by Step Guide: How to Set Up a Business in RAK Free Zone
Step 1: Choose Your Business Activity
Decide the nature of your business. RAKEZ offers over 1,500 licensed activities across sectors like:
- Trading and general commerce
- Consultancy and services
- Industrial and manufacturing
- Media and education
- E-commerce and technology
Each activity type determines the kind of license you’ll need and the number of visas you can apply for.
Step 2: Select the Company Type
RAKEZ allows several company structures, such as:
- Free Zone Establishment (FZE): For a single shareholder.
- Free Zone Company (FZC): For two or more shareholders.
- Branch of a Local or Foreign Company: For existing UAE or international firms expanding to RAK.
Step 3: Choose a Business Facility
RAK offers diverse options depending on your business needs and budget:
- Flexi Desks & Shared Offices (for startups and freelancers)
- Standard Offices & Business Centers
- Warehouses & Industrial Land (for manufacturers and logistics firms)
- Custom built Facilities within the RAKEZ industrial zones
Step 4: Register the Company Name
Select and reserve your trade name through RAKEZ’s online portal. The name must comply with UAE naming regulations – avoiding religious terms, political references, or duplicate trade names.
Step 5: Submit Documents & Pay Fees
Provide all required documents such as:
- Passport copies of shareholders and managers
- Business plan (for certain activities)
- Proof of residence (utility bill or tenancy contract)
- NOC (for UAE residents under employment visa)
After submission, you’ll receive initial approval and payment instructions.
Step 6: Obtain License and Establishment Card
Once all formalities are completed, RAKEZ issues your business license and establishment card. You can then open a corporate bank account, apply for visas, and begin operations.
Step 7: Apply for UAE Residence Visa
RAKEZ offers investor, partner, and employee visa packages with varying validity periods.
Ras Al Khaimah free zone visa rules allow flexible options, from single investor visas to multi employee sponsorships, based on your selected facility size and business activity.

RAK Free Zone Company Setup Cost (2025-26 Overview)
One of the most appealing aspects of business setup in Ras Al Khaimah Free Zone is its affordability.
Approximate setup cost:
- Service / Consultancy License: AED 8,000 to 10,000
- Commercial / Trading License: AED 10,000 to 15,000
- Industrial License: AED 15,000 to 20,000 (plus warehouse rental)
Visa packages and office space options can affect the total cost.

Business Setup Timeline
RAK Free Zone setup is known for its efficiency.
- Trade Name Approval: 1 to 2 days
- Initial Approval & Document Submission: 2 to 3 days
- License Issuance: 3 to 5 working days
In total, you can expect your business to be operational within 7 to 10 working days.

2. Can I get a UAE residence visa through RAK Free Zone?
Yes, you can obtain a UAE residence visa through your company in the RAK Free Zone. Once your business is registered and your establishment card is issued, you can apply for an Investor, Partner, or Employee Visa under RAKEZ. Investor visas typically have a validity of 2 or 3 years and can be renewed easily. The number of visas you’re eligible for depends on the size of your selected office or facility type. For example, flexi-desk packages may allow 1–2 visas, while dedicated offices and warehouses allow more. The visa process includes medical testing, Emirates ID application, and visa stamping. One of the major benefits is that it allows you to sponsor family members as well. 3. What documents are required for company formation?
The documents needed for a RAK Free Zone company setup are straightforward and depend on your chosen structure (individual or corporate). Generally, you’ll need passport copies of shareholders and managers, passport-size photos, a recent utility bill or tenancy contract as proof of address, and a detailed business plan if you’re setting up a consultancy or industrial unit. For corporate shareholders, additional documents like a Board Resolution, Certificate of Incorporation, and Memorandum & Articles of Association (MOA/AOA) are required. If any documents are issued outside the UAE, they must be notarized and attested by the UAE Embassy. 4. Can I operate outside the free zone?
Yes, you can operate outside the Free Zone, but with some conditions. Companies established in Ras Al Khaimah Free Zone can freely conduct international trade or do business with other free zones across the UAE. However, if you plan to trade directly within the UAE mainland, you must appoint a local distributor or commercial agent with a mainland license issued by the Department of Economic Development (DED). This ensures compliance with UAE’s business regulations. Many investors choose this hybrid model, maintaining their Free Zone license for global operations while collaborating with mainland entities for local trade.
